A 14ct. gold hunting cased chronometer pocket watch, circa 1910, white enamel dial inscribed Chronometre, Arabic numerals, subsidiary seconds, frosted gilt movement jewelled to the centre, pivoted detent with spiral spring, bi-metallic compensation balance with helical spring, micrometer adjustment to the regulator, gold cuvette, engine turned case with vacant cartouche, diameter 59mm.
